Taking to Instagram at the top of the year, the funnyman was doing anything but laughing when he posted a clip from Lopez’s residency (like the one above) to lambast the diva’s vocal performances.

To the people that get upset with the people that critique J Lo’s singing and call them haters and say her voice is beautiful,

what is wrong with you guys? Are you that delusional and sensitive what is wrong with your ears? She’s off key she’s not on pitch and she can barely hold certain notes,”

he told his 1.6 million followers on the platform at the time. “It’s not hate, it’s honesty.”

The staunch criticism quickly rubbed fans of the ‘Get Right’ singer the wrong way, earning him jeers in the comment section of the clip.

Jennifer Lopez looks good for her age, but she can’t sing worth a damn. When you [think of] Mariah Carey, Chaka Khan, Aretha Franklin,

Whitney Houston, and Celine Dion, we’re talking about female vocalists who bring the thunder,” he told VLAD. “People make excuses [for J.Lo] and say, ‘she never said she was the best singer.’ Well, then don’t f-cking sing! Why do you have a residency in Vegas?”

When later quizzed by Big Boy about the negative reaction he’s gotten from commenters about his continued criticism of J.Lo, Aries stood his ground.

“The people online and in your comments will say, ‘oh, you’re a hater.’ [I’m not], I’m honest and I’m opinionated. We’re not allowed to be that any more,”

Spears said to Big Boy when asked about the backlash. “I’m just stating facts. Like in that clip I posted, it’s clear; she’s off key, off pitch, and can’t hold certain notes…”
